一、安装主DNS服务器
1,配置主DNS
<代码> [root@centos01 ~] # yum - y安装绑定bind-chroot bind-utils,,& lt; !——安装DNS依赖程序——比;
# cp/etc/named. root@centos01 ~conf/etc/named.conf。贝克,& lt; !——备份主配置文件——比;
(root@centos01 ~) #回声“;“比;/etc/named.相依,,,& lt; !——清空主配置文件内容→
# vim/etc/named. root@centos01 ~相依,,,,& lt; !——编辑主配置文件——比;
{选项,,,,,,,& lt; !——全局配置文件——比;
,监听大敌;港口,,53{任何;};,,,& lt; !——53号端口监听所有IP地址——比;
,,目录“/var/named";,,,,,& lt; !——区域配置文件位置——比;
};
区,,“benet.com"在时间{大敌;;,,,,& lt; !——正向解析区域名称——比;
,类型的大敌;,主;,,,,,,,,,,,& lt; !——主DNS服务器——比;
,,文件,“benet.com.zone";,,,,,& lt; !——正向解析区域配置文件名字——比;
,,允许转让{192.168.100.20;};,,,& lt; !——备用DNSIP地址——比;
};
区,,“accp.com",在{
,类型的大敌;,主;
,,文件,“accp.com.zone";
,,允许转让{192.168.100.20;};
};
(root@centos01 ~) # named-checkconf - z/etc/named.相依,& lt; !——检查主配置文件是否错误——在代码>
2,配置驱魔师区域的正向解析区域
<代码> [root@centos01 ~] # vim/var/named/benet.com.zone, & lt; !——编制驱魔师的正向解析配置文件——比;
TTL美元,,86400年,,,& lt; !——解析资源记录有效时间24小时——比;
@,SOA benet.com。,root.benet.com (,,,& lt; !——域名为benet.com——比;
,,2020020910,,,& lt; !——更新序列号——比;
,1 h大敌;,,,,,& lt; !——刷新时间1小时——比;
,,15米,,,,,,& lt; !——重试时间15分钟——比;
,1 w的大敌;,,,,& lt; !——失效时间1周——比;
,1 d大敌;,,,,,& lt; !——无效解析记录保存时间1天,在
)
@,NS, centos01.benet.com。& lt; !——主权威服务器是DNS完全合格域名——比;
,NS大敌;centos02.benet.com。,,,,,,,& lt; !——备祝辞
centos01一个时间192.168.100.10大敌;;,,,& lt; !——记录正向解析条目——比;
centos02一个时间192.168.100.20大敌;;,,,& lt; !——记录正向解析条目——比;
ftp,时间192.168.100.10大敌;;,,,,& lt; !——ftp服务器IP地址——比;
www的时间192.168.100.10大敌;;,,,,& lt; !——网站服务器IP地址——比;
(root@centos01 ~) # named-checkzone benet.com/var/named/benet.com.zone, & lt; !——检查正向解析区域配置文件是否正常——比;
区benet.com/IN:串行加载2020020910
好吧
[root@centos01 ~] # chmod 755/var/named/benet.com.zone,,,,
,,& lt; !——驱魔师正向解析区域配置文件添加权限——比;
(root@centos01 ~) #乔恩命名:命名/var/named/benet.com.zone,,,,
,,,,,,,& lt; !——修改属主属组,在代码>
3,配置accp区域的正向解析区域
<代码> [root@centos01 ~] # cp/var/named/benet.com.zone,/var/叫/accp.com.zone,,
& lt; !——复制驱魔师正向解析区域配置文件到accp正向解析区域配置文件——比;
# vim/var/named/accp.com.zone root@centos01 ~
,,,,,& lt; !——编辑accp正向解析区域配置文件——比;
TTL美元,86400年,
@,SOA accp.com。,root.accp.com (
,,2020020910
,,1小时
,,15米
,,1 w
,,1 d
)
@,NS, centos01.accp.com。,,,,
,NS大敌;centos02.accp.com。,,,,
centos01一个时间192.168.100.10大敌;;,,
ftp,时间192.168.100.10大敌;;,,,,,
www的时间192.168.100.10大敌;;,,,,
(root@centos01 ~) # named-checkzone accp.com/var/named/accp.com.zone,
,,,& lt; !——检查accp正向解析区域配置文件是否正常——比;,,
区accp.com/IN:串行加载2020020910
好的代码>
4,启动DNS服务
<代码> [root@centos01 ~] # systemctl开始命名,,,,,& lt; !——启动服务——比;
(root@centos01 ~) # systemctl启用命名,& lt; !——设置服务开机自动启动——比;,,代码>
5,网卡添加DNS
<代码> [root@centos01 ~] # vim/etc/sysconfig/network-scripts/ifcfg-ens32,,,& lt; !——编辑网卡配置文件——比;,,
DNS1=192.168.100.20,,,,,& lt; !——添加主DNS(主从互指)——比;,,
DNS2=192.168.100.10,,,,,,& lt; !——备用DNS——比;,,
(root@centos01 ~) # systemctl重启网络& lt; !——重新启动网卡服务——比;,,
(root@centos01 ~) # systemctl重启名叫& lt; !——重新启动DNS服务——比;,,代码>
二、安装从DNS服务器
1,配置从DNS